I recall endless discussions about xref in the past.
But now I realized that xref-goto-xref just misses
an obvious thing, and nothing more is needed.

Like e.g. 'quit-window' allows using a prefix argument
to change its behavior by relying on (interactive "P"),
xref-goto-xref should do the same:

diff --git a/lisp/progmodes/xref.el b/lisp/progmodes/xref.el
index a1c4c08c26..e1dd6e56bb 100644
--- a/lisp/progmodes/xref.el
+++ b/lisp/progmodes/xref.el
@@ -600,9 +600,9 @@ xref--item-at-point
 
 (defun xref-goto-xref (&optional quit)
   "Jump to the xref on the current line and select its window.
-Non-interactively, non-nil QUIT means to first quit the *xref*
-buffer."
-  (interactive)
+Non-interactively, non-nil QUIT, or interactively, with prefix argument
+means to first quit the *xref* buffer."
+  (interactive "P")
   (let* ((buffer (current-buffer))
          (xref (or (xref--item-at-point)
                    (user-error "No reference at point")))
